Book excerpt: This book provides a thorough exploration of the intersection between gender-based healthcare disparities and the transformative potential of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ML). It covers a wide range of topics from fundamental concepts to practical applications. Transforming Gender-Based Healthcare with AI and Machine Learning incorporates real-world case studies and success stories to illustrate how AI and ML are actively reshaping gender-based healthcare and offers examples that showcase tangible outcomes and the impact of technology in healthcare settings. The book delves into the ethical considerations surrounding the use of AI and ML in healthcare and addresses issues related to privacy, bias, and responsible technology implementation. Empasis is placed on patient-centered care, and the book discusses how technology empowers individuals to actively participate in their healthcare decisions and promotes a more engaged and informed patient population. Written to encourage interdisciplinary collaboration and highlight the importance of cooperation between health professionals, technologies, researchers, and policymakers, this book portrays how this collaborative approach is essential for achieving transformative goals and is not only for professionals but can also be used at the student level as well.
